Awards for young people

The Transport Design Award encourages proposed transport design research at graduate or fellowship level.

The Carmen's Sword of Honour is given to the young officer selected by the Royal Logistic Corps as the most outstanding of the year.

The Carmen's RAF Cup recognises the best student officer for the preceding year attending the Movements School.

The Carmen's Royal Navy Cup goes to the outstanding officer pan-Navy within logistics, covering Navy, Marines, and Fleet Auxiliary.

The Carmen's Engineering Apprentice of the Year is for the outstanding apprentice nominated by the Society of Operating Engineers.

The Carmen's Transport Apprentice of the Year is for the best advanced apprentice nominated by the Road Haulage & Distribution Industry Training Board.

In 2004 awards were increased to include;

Soldier of the Year Award for the outstanding Royal Logistic Corps young man or woman on first tour, any trade background;

RAF Movements School NCO judged top of all annual courses;

 

 

 

Driver of the Year Award for the outstanding driver within 2 Mechanical Transport Squadron RAF, and

24 Squadron RAF Carmen's Cup for outstanding commitment to the Squadron.

In 2006 these were joined by the Royal Navy Medal for all other ranks pan Navy in logistics.
